Standard Twin Mattress Dimensions

Twin mattresses are a popular choice for children's bedrooms, guest rooms, and even smaller master bedrooms. They offer a comfortable and affordable option for those looking for a smaller bed size. But before you purchase a twin mattress, it's important to know the standard twin mattress dimensions to ensure it fits properly in your space.

The standard twin mattress size measures 39 inches by 75 inches, making it the smallest of the adult mattress sizes. This size is also referred to as a single mattress, and it is commonly used in bunk beds or daybeds. It's important to note that the standard twin mattress dimensions may vary slightly by brand, so always double check the exact measurements before purchasing.

If you're looking for a bed that can accommodate taller individuals, you may want to consider a twin XL mattress, which is 5 inches longer than a standard twin. This can be a great option for teens or adults who need a little extra legroom.

Full Mattress Dimensions

If you're in need of a larger bed than a twin, but don't quite have enough space for a queen, a full mattress may be the perfect fit. Full mattress dimensions measure 54 inches by 75 inches, making them 15 inches wider than a twin but still 6 inches narrower than a queen. This makes them a great option for solo sleepers who want a little extra room to spread out.

It's important to note that full mattresses may also be referred to as a double mattress due to their ability to accommodate two people, although it may be a bit of a tight squeeze. However, if you have a smaller guest room or need a bed for a growing child, a full mattress size may be the perfect solution.

Twin Mattress Measurements

The exact twin mattress measurements may vary slightly by brand, but the standard twin mattress dimensions are typically 39 inches by 75 inches. These measurements are important to keep in mind when purchasing a twin mattress, as you want to ensure it will fit properly in your space.

It's also important to consider the thickness of the mattress, which can range from 5 inches to 14 inches. A thicker mattress may provide more support and comfort, but it may also be more difficult to find fitted sheets that fit properly. Be sure to measure the thickness of your mattress as well when shopping for bedding.

Full Mattress Measurements

Similar to a twin mattress, the full mattress measurements may also vary slightly by brand. However, the standard full mattress dimensions are typically 54 inches by 75 inches. It's important to measure your space and consider the thickness of the mattress to ensure a proper fit.

When shopping for bedding for a full mattress, keep in mind that you may need to purchase deep pocket fitted sheets to accommodate the height of the mattress. This is especially important if you have a thicker mattress or use a mattress topper.
